Riyadh is the capital and also the biggest city of Saudi Arabia, and it is both the provincial and governorate capital of the Riyadh Province and Governorate. Sitting right in the middle of the an-Nafud desert on the eastern side of the Najd plateau, it is the largest city in the Arabian Peninsular. Located at 600 meters above sea level, Riyadh is estimated to accommodate 5,000,000 tourists a year, making the city stand forty-ninth in the world's most visited city and 6th in the Middle East.
Some of the tourist attractions in Riyadh are the Masmak Kingdom archeological site, the Kingdom Tower, and the National Museum of Saudi Arabia. 4. What is the best time to visit Riyadh?
Because of the country's beautiful climate, the months of November to February are the best ones to travel to Riyadh. Scheduling a trip outside of April to October will assist you avoid the high temperatures all over the summer, which should be avoided.
